Assigning Actions to Buttons
There are three buttons on your mouse that can be customized to perform
an action, effect or bring up a tool. Let's say you wanted to use the Zoom In
command with one of the buttons. The zoom effect is listed under display in
the action list. If it is not currently open, click on the arrow next to "Display"
to open the list. Click and drag "Zoom In" from the action list to the button
you want to assign. When you release the button, it will now show the "Zoom
In" icon.
Some actions and effects have customizable parameters. When you assign
one of these items, it will instantly ask for your preferences. Set your desired
preference and click the green check mark to save those settings. You can

Assigning Actions to Gestures
In addition to the buttons, you can also customize what happens when you
swipe with the remote. Swiping is done by pressing and holding the Swipe
Button (7) until a circle appears on the screen. Then, moving the mouse to
one of the cardinal directions shown (up, down, left or right), release the but-
ton to bring up the action you've configured for that direction. To change an
action assigned to a gesture, click the "Gestures" tab on the left, then drag
and drop your intended action to the gesture icon showing that direction.
